Driving Schools in Lincoln Hub
Lincoln, Nebraska's capital and home to the University of Nebraska, offers a college-town driving environment with state government traffic. The city is smaller and more manageable than Omaha, making it accessible for new drivers.
Lincoln driving schools balance urban skills with preparation for rural Nebraska driving. The university brings many first-time drivers, and the state capitol area has its own traffic patterns.

Frequently Asked Questions
How does Nebraska football affect traffic?
Game days transform Lincoln traffic. Schools teach event awareness and avoidance strategies.
Is Lincoln good for new drivers?
Yes, smaller and more manageable than Omaha while still providing urban experience.
What about winter driving?
Essential skill in Nebraska. All schools emphasize winter preparedness.
